Maintaining a strong online presence is crucial for businesses to enhance visibility, engage with customers, and drive growth in today’s digital landscape. Here’s a comprehensive guide to help you establish and sustain a robust online presence:
1. Develop a Professional Website
– Responsive Design: Ensure your website is mobile-friendly and responsive to provide a seamless user experience across devices.
– Clear Navigation: Design an intuitive layout with easy navigation to help visitors find information quickly and efficiently.
– Optimized Content: Regularly update content with relevant information, products, services, and blog posts that resonate with your target audience.
2.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
– Keyword Optimization: Conduct keyword research to identify relevant search terms and integrate them naturally into your website content.
– Meta Tags and Descriptions: Optimize meta tags, titles, and s to improve click-through rates from search engine results pages (SERPs).
– Quality Backlinks: Build quality backlinks from reputable websites to enhance your site’s authority and search engine ranking.
3. Content Marketing Strategy
– Content Creation: Develop a content calendar and plan to regularly publish high-quality content that educates, entertains, or solves problems for your audience.
– Variety of Formats: Experiment with different content formats such as blog articles, videos, infographics, podcasts, and webinars to cater to diverse preferences.
4. Social Media Engagement
– Platform Selection: Choose social media platforms where your target audience is most active and maintain a consistent presence.
– Interactive Content: Share engaging content, respond to comments and messages promptly, and participate in relevant conversations to build relationships.
5. Online Reputation Management
– Monitor Online Presence: Regularly monitor online reviews, mentions, and comments about your brand to address customer feedback promptly and maintain a positive reputation.
– Respond Strategically: Respond to both positive and negative feedback professionally and transparently to demonstrate customer care and willingness to resolve issues.
6. Email Marketing
– Segmented Campaigns: Implement segmented email campaigns to deliver personalized content, promotions, and updates based on subscriber preferences and behaviors.
– Automation Tools: Use email marketing automation tools to streamline workflows, send targeted messages, and nurture leads through the sales funnel.
7. Analytics and Measurement
– Website Analytics: Utilize tools like Google Analytics to track website traffic, user behavior, conversion rates, and other key performance indicators (KPIs).
– Social Media Insights: Analyze engagement metrics, audience demographics, and campaign performance on social media platforms to optimize content strategy.
8. Brand Consistency and Messaging
– Unified Brand Voice: Maintain consistency in brand messaging, visual identity, and tone across all online channels to reinforce brand recognition and credibility.
– Customer-Centric Approach: Focus on addressing customer needs, preferences, and pain points through personalized communication and solutions.
9. Customer Engagement and Community Building
– Interactive Platforms: Encourage customer engagement through polls, surveys, contests, and user-generated content to foster a sense of community around your brand.
– Customer Support: Provide responsive customer support via social media, live chat, and email to en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ty.
10. Adaptability and Innovation
– Stay Updated: Stay informed about digital marketing trends, technological advancements, and industry innovations to adapt strategies and stay ahead of competitors.
– Continuous Improvement: Regularly review and refine your online presence strategy based on performance data, customer feedback, and market dynamics to achieve sustained growth.
By implementing these strategies and maintaining a proactive approach to online presence management, businesses can enhance brand visibility, engage with their target audience effectively, and drive business success in the digital age. Consistency, quality content, and customer-centricity are key to building and sustaining a strong online presence that resonates with customers and supports long-term growth objectives.
